Sam Langford was a center fielder in MLB history. Across 131 career games, with a .275 batting average and 5 home runs. This page covers season stats, team history, and career profile.

Season-by-Season Batting
← Scroll for more →
Year Team G AB R H 2B 3B HR RBI SB BB SO AVG OBP SLG OPS
1926 BOS 1 1 1 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 .000 .000 .000 .000
1927 CLE 20 67 10 18 5 0 1 7 0 5 7 .269 .347 .388 .735
1928 CLE 110 427 50 118 17 8 4 50 3 21 35 .276 .312 .382 .694
Career Totals 131 495 61 136 22 8 5 57 3 26 42 .275 .316 .382 .698
